Hengli high alumina insulating block is manufactured from premium refractory materials, shaped through advanced extrusion or casting techniques, and sintered in a high-temperature natural gas tunnel kiln. Our product undergoes precise sawing and grinding using state-of-the-art machinery. This high alumina insulating block features a uniform structure, precise dimensions, exceptional strength, low iron content, minimal thermal conductivity, and excellent reheating linear change.     High alumina insulating blocks are specialized refractory materials that are used in various high-temperature applications due to their unique properties. Some key features of high alumina insulating blocks include:

    • Thermal Insulation: They have low thermal conductivity, making them highly effective at reducing heat loss and maintaining high temperatures in furnaces and kilns.
    • Mechanical Strength: They exhibit good mechanical strength and resistance to abrasion, which ensures durability and longevity in harsh conditions.
    • Lightweight: Despite their strength and durability, high alumina insulating blocks are relatively lightweight, which makes them easier to handle and install.
    • Dimensional Stability: They maintain their shape and structural integrity under high-temperature conditions, minimizing deformation and cracking.
    • Energy Efficiency: By providing excellent insulation, these blocks help in conserving energy and reducing operational costs in high-temperature processes.

    Typical Application

    "Vibration Cast Fireclay Block for Glass Furnace" is commonly used for insulation in the bottom and sidewalls of glass furnaces. These fireclay bricks not only effectively insulate, preventing the outward spread of heat and maintaining a stable high-temperature environment inside the glass furnace, but also possess high strength characteristics. Their unique vibration casting process gives these bricks uniform density and excellent refractory performance, enabling them to withstand the high temperatures and impacts generated during glass furnace operations, ensuring stability and reliability during long-term operation.

    Typical Indexes

    Items Unit FLG-1.2 FLG-1.0 FLG-0.8 FLG-0.7 FLG-0.6
    Al2O3 % ≥ 48 ≥ 48 ≥ 48 ≥ 48 ≥ 48
    Fe2O3 % ≤ 2.0 ≤ 2.0 ≤ 2.0 ≤ 2.0 ≤ 2.0
    Bulk Density g/cm³ 1.2-1.3 1 0.8 0.7 0.6
    Cold Crushing Strength MPa 15 4 3 2.5 2
    Reheating Linear Change no more than 2% % 1400 1400 1400 1350 1350
    Thermal Conductivity @350 ± 10°C W/m·K 0.55 0.5 0.35 0.35 0.3
